• ADADADADAD

    kafka如何保证数据有序性[ 电脑知识 ]

    电脑知识 时间:2024-12-03 15:01:45

    作者:文/会员上传

    简介:

    Kafka保证数据有序性主要依靠分区和分区内的消息顺序。分区:Kafka的主题被分为多个分区,每个分区都是一个有序的队列。生产者发送的消息会按照分区的规则被分配到不同的分区中

    以下为本文的正文内容,内容仅供参考!本站为公益性网站,复制本文以及下载DOC文档全部免费。

    Kafka保证数据有序性主要依靠分区和分区内的消息顺序。

      分区:Kafka的主题被分为多个分区,每个分区都是一个有序的队列。生产者发送的消息会按照分区的规则被分配到不同的分区中,同一个分区内的消息是有序的。

      分区内的消息顺序:在同一个分区内,消息是有序的,即先发送的消息会先被消费。Kafka保证了每个分区内的消息顺序是有序的。

      消费者组:消费者可以以消费者组的形式进行消息消费,每个消费者组内的消费者会按照分区的规则分配不同的分区,这样可以保证每个消费者只消费一个分区内的消息,从而保证了消息的顺序性。

    总的来说,Kafka通过分区和消费者组来保证数据的有序性,不同的分区内消息是有序的,消费者组内的消费者会按照分区的规则消费消息,从而保证整体的消息有序性。

    kafka如何保证数据有序性.docx

    将本文的Word文档下载到电脑

    推荐度:

    下载
    热门标签: Kafka